A peaceful start on the Martha Brae River

Explore Montego bay Jamaica toMartha Brae Rafting &Blue Hole Tour - A peaceful start on the Martha Brae River

Your day begins with pickup in Montego Bay and a drive to the Martha Brae River. The exact pickup time is arranged within the listed morning window of 8:00 to 10:00 a.m., Monday through Friday. An air-conditioned vehicle matters here, since you will spend part of the day on Jamaican roads before reaching the river.

At Martha Brae, you board a hand-made bamboo raft for a slow trip through thick tropical vegetation. This is the softer half of the outing. You are not racing down rapids or signing up for an adrenaline activity. The point is to sit back, watch the greenery pass, and let the river set the pace.

I like this opening because it gives you time to settle into the day. The raft ride offers a quiet counterpoint to the activity waiting at Blue Hole. If your ideal Jamaican outing includes scenery, fresh air, and a relaxed start, Martha Brae does that job well.

The private raft is also a useful feature for couples, families, or small groups who want to enjoy the setting without being folded into a large party. Your experience remains centered on your own group, and the private driver stays responsible for your transportation between stops.

The information provided does not give a precise rafting time, so you should not assume that every part of the eight-hour day is spent on the river. The total includes transportation and the Blue Hole visit. That makes the tour convenient, but the day will feel full rather than leisurely.

From calm water to Blue Hole near Ocho Rios

Explore Montego bay Jamaica toMartha Brae Rafting &Blue Hole Tour - From calm water to Blue Hole near Ocho Rios

After Martha Brae, your driver takes you toward Blue Hole River and Falls in the Ocho Rios area. This is where the pace changes. You can swim, use rope swings, walk on a bush trail, and jump from waterfalls. The stop is built around active participation, not simply looking at scenery.

I like the way these two attractions work together. Martha Brae lets you enjoy Jamaica from a seated raft, while Blue Hole gives you a chance to get into the water and test your nerve. You can choose how much activity suits you, though the tour information makes clear that a moderate fitness level is expected.

Blue Hole is likely to be the part you remember most clearly if you enjoy physical activities. Rope swinging and waterfall jumping are not minor add-ons here. They are central to the visit. Swimming gives you a less demanding option, while the bush hike adds a short land-based element between the water activities.

You should bring a swimsuit, a change of clothes, and footwear suited to wet conditions, although only some of this is directly specified by the tour information. Water shoes are specifically not included, so you need to supply them yourself if you want extra grip and protection. A water-resistant phone case is also left to you.

The operator does not list lunch as included. Plan accordingly, but do not assume that a meal is provided during the day. Since this is an eight-hour outing, food planning is worth handling before you leave or confirming directly when booking.

Weather, cancellations, and practical booking advice

Explore Montego bay Jamaica toMartha Brae Rafting &Blue Hole Tour - Weather, cancellations, and practical booking advice

The activity requires good weather. If poor weather cancels it, you are offered another date or a full refund. The same applies if the minimum number of participants is not met and the operator cancels the booking.

You can cancel for a full refund if you do so at least 24 hours before the start time. Cancellations made within 24 hours are not refunded, and changes during that period are not accepted. The cut-off uses local time.

The best practical approach is to book early enough to preserve flexibility, then avoid scheduling it on your final day in Jamaica. That gives you room to move the outing if weather interferes. It also keeps a delayed return from affecting a flight or another important reservation.

Bring clothing suitable for both stops. You will want to be comfortable on a raft, then ready for swimming and waterfall activities. Since water shoes and a phone case are not included, arrange those before pickup rather than hoping to find them during the day.
